bayhaqi:17046ʿAlī b. Aḥmad b. ʿAbdān > Aḥmad b. ʿUbayd > al-Asfāṭī > Abū Bakr b. Abū Shaybah > Maʿmar b. Sulaymān > Ḥajjāj > ʿAbd al-Jabbār b. Wāʾil from his father

[Machine] A woman was forced during the time of the Prophet Muhammad ﷺ , and the punishment prescribed for her was waived. The Prophet Muhammad ﷺ upheld the decision that was in her favor and did not mention that he would give her a dowry. In this chain of narration, there is weakness from two aspects: one is that Al-Hajjaj did not hear from Abdul Jabbar, and the other is that Abdul Jabbar did not hear from his father. Al-Bukhari and others have reported this.
